The Very First Alvin Show – DVD Review

AlvinShow

Here it is, the first Alvin and the Chipmunks cartoon ever! Called The Alvin Show, the series premiered in 1961 and contains plenty of music, comedy, and Chipmunk shenanigans. See how Alvin, Simon, and Theodore got their starts; where Dave came into the picture, and find out who Clyde Crashcup is.

The animation is reminiscent of Rocky & Bullwinkle and George of the Jungle, which makes it all the more awesome to watch. This is classic TV animation at its best, and certainly is evidence of the characters’ sustainability over the past forty-plus years.

Along with the series premiere, you also get two bonus eps of the series: “A Chipmunk Reunion,” and “The Chipmunks Present: Rockin’ Through the Decades.” You can go wrong with this family-friendly series that is safe for everyone to enjoy.

Two decades later, the Chipmunks would return to TV with Alvin and the Chipmunks, and later with the movie satire series Alvin and the Chipmunks Go to the Movies. Check out my review of Go to the Movies by clicking here.
